Show and sale of Beltex hoggets impresses judge
Caledonian Marts Ltd, Stirling, sold 2,681 prime hoggets, ewes and tups in conjunction with the show and sale of Beltex hoggets which was kindly sponsored by Beltex Scotland Club. The judge for the day was Jimmy Stark, Milton of Campsie, and the following were his awards: Champion and 1st prize (42.1-46kg): DS and RC Taylor, Easter Ochtermuthill, 45kg @ £140 or 311ppkg purchased by the judge, MJ Stark, Bluebell, Milton of Campsie. Reserve champion and 1st prize (up to 42kg): M McDonald, Newbigging, 41kg @ £120 or 293ppkg, again purchased by MJ Stark. 42.1-46kg – 2nd Murray Bell, Craigend, 42kg @ £104; 3rd Murray Bell, Craigend, 45kg @ £104. Up to 42kg – 2nd M McDonald, Newbigging, 38kg @ £92; 3rd M McDonald, Newbigging, 41kg @ £97. 46kg+ – 1st Murray Bell, Craigend, 49kg @ £109; 2nd J Guthrie, Cuiltburn, 55kg @ £126; 3rd J Guthrie, Cuiltburn, 51kg @ £109. The overall sale average for 2,018 hoggets sold was 206.94ppkg (-1.1p on the week).
